Boiled Peanuts

Boiled peanuts make a delicious snack!

INGRIDIENT

DIRECTION

Step: 1

Wash the peanuts and place them in a pot. Add salt and water. Bring the water to a boil.

Step: 2

Let the water boil for 3 hours.

Step: 3

Taste the peanuts, if they are not salty enough for your taste add more salt. If you would like the peanuts to be softer, return the water to boil and cook until they reach the consistency you desire.
